Tearna Sankofa, Alaine Sankofa v. Eric Ifu Ho, Wen-Ying Chu Ho, and Does 1 through 20
Published: Jul. 31, 2010 | Result Date: May 13, 2010 | Filing Date: Jan. 1, 1900 |Case number: RG09432556 Verdict – $6,196
Facts
On April 1, 2008, a vehicle driven by defendant Eric Ho collided with a vehicle driven by plaintiff Tearna Sankofa. Sankofa and her mother, Alaine Sankofa, filed an action against Ho and Wen-Ying Ho, who owned the vehicle. Prior to trial, Alaine dismissed her claim and Wen-Ying Ho was dismissed as a defendant.
Contentions
PLAINTIFF'S CONTENTIONS:
Plaintiff claimed that Ho operated the vehicle in a negligent manner. Further, plaintiff argued that Ho ran a stop sign and unexpectedly drove out in front of Tearna.
DEFENDANT'S CONTENTIONS:
Defendant conceded responsibility before trial such that damages were the only issue in court.
Damages
Plaintiff sought $25,000.
Injuries
Plaintiff claimed back and neck injuries, requiring chiropractic care, massage, and physical therapy.
Result
The jury awarded plaintiff $6,196, which included $4,396 in past medical costs, $600 in past loss of wages, and $1,200 in past non-economic damages.
